How to prepare for a job interview at Pennon Group

Know Your Renewable Energy Stuff

Make sure you brush up on the latest trends and technologies in renewable energy. Pennon Power Limited is all about sustainability, so showing that you understand their mission and can discuss relevant projects will definitely impress them.

Show Off Your Analytical Skills

As an Analyst, you'll need to demonstrate your ability to interpret data effectively.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've used data analysis to drive decisions or improve processes. Be ready to explain your thought process clearly.

Practice Your Dutch

Since this role requires Dutch speaking skills, make sure you're comfortable conversing in Dutch. You might be asked to discuss technical topics in Dutch during the interview, so practice common phrases and industry-specific vocabulary to boost your confidence.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are some insightful questions about Pennon Power Limited's projects and future goals. This shows your genuine interest in the company and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you.
